FG54 EKV is a 2004 Ford Galaxy in Silver with a 1,896c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.9%.
Across all 2004 Ford Galaxy models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.4% with a typical mileage of 97,799 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Galaxy f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 102,272 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FG54 EKV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Galaxy typ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 22 years old, this Ford Galaxy is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
